Oracle Text

{1}{W} (You may cast this card face down for {3} as a 2/2 creature with ward {2}. Turn it face up any time for its cost.)

When this creature is turned face up, exile another target nonland permanent. If you controlled it, return it to the battlefield tapped. Otherwise, its controller creates a 2/2 white and blue Detective creature token.

Rulings14

2/2/2024·wotc

Any time you have priority, you may turn the face-down creature face up by revealing what its disguise cost is and paying that cost. This is a special action. It doesn't use the stack and can't be responded to. Only a face-down permanent can be turned face up this way; a face-down spell cannot.

2/2/2024·wotc

You must ensure that your face-down spells and permanents can be easily differentiated from each other. You're not allowed to mix up the cards that represent them on the battlefield to confuse other players. The order in which they entered the battlefield should remain clear, as well as what ability caused them to be face down. (This includes disguise, cloak, and in games involving older cards, morph and manifest, as well as a few other effects that turn cards face down.) Common methods for doing this include using markers or dice, or simply placing them in order on the battlefield.

2/2/2024·wotc

A permanent that turns face up or face down changes characteristics but is otherwise the same permanent. Spells and abilities that were targeting that permanent and Auras and Equipment that were attached to that permanent aren't affected unless the new characteristics of the object change the legality of those targets or attachments.
